One thing I can always say about Rene's mother is that every time she ends a phone call or goes home after a family get together she always says to us "I love you". Our daughter is very good at that and my aunt always lets you know that you are loved. Rene and I try hard to make expressing our love to others a good habit.

As rough and tough as I claim to be, I will admit that those three little words mean the world to me and sometimes they are just what I needed to hear. God is the same way. Throughout Scripture he lets us know in written word that He loves us. Bible verses on how God loves me are some of my favorites.

John 3:16  “For God so loved the world, that he gave his only Son, that whoever believes in him should not perish but have eternal life.
Romans 5:8 but God shows his love for us in that while we were still sinners, Christ died for us.
Galatians 2:20 I have been crucified with Christ. It is no longer I who live, but Christ who lives in me. And the life I now live in the flesh I live by faith in the Son of God. who loved me and gave himself for me.
Ephesians 2:4-5 But God, being rich in mercy, because of the great love with which he loved us, even when we were dead in our trespasses, made us alive together with Christ— by grace you have been saved—
1 John 4:9-11 In this the love of God was made manifest among us, that God sent his only Son into the world, so that we might live through him. In this is love, not that we have loved God but that he loved us and sent his Son to be the propitiation for our sins. Beloved, if God so loved us, we also ought to love one another.
Zephaniah 3:17 The LORD your God is in your midst, a mighty one who will save; he will rejoice over you with gladness; he will quiet you by his love; he will exult over you with loud singing

God never tells us anything that isn't important. He clearly wants us to know how much we are loved and He tells us so. So without hesitating at all, we should let others know that they are loved by us. It is important to affirm our actions in words.
Love someone? Tell them! By the way. I love you all!
